Does the Charlotte Convention Center offer assistance for visitors with disabilities?

The Charlotte Convention Center is committed to accommodating the needs of individuals with disabilities. The CCC is accessible to disabled patrons as required by the ADA and applicable regulations.

  • Accessible restrooms, family restrooms and lower height water fountains are available throughout the facility.
  • Disability parking is available at prevailing rates in the NASCAR Hall of Fame parking deck adjacent to the CCC. Attendees must display proper identification on their vehicle.
  • Drivers may drop off and pick up passengers with mobility concerns in the taxi lane, located on College Street. Attendees must call the Security desk at 704-339-6090 for assistance.
  • There are two Mother’s Rooms located in the CCC (across from room W211 and by the Richardson Ballroom Section B). Each is equipped with a chair, stool, and refrigerator. These rooms are private and can be locked.

I plan to drive to the show. How do I get there and where do I park?

Two major highways, I-85 and I-77, connect Charlotte to cities in the Northeast, Southeast and Midwest. Less than one hour north, I-40 provides an east/west link with coast-to-coast access.

  • From I-77 North/US Highway 74 West (Wilkinson Boulevard)/Airport, exit off I-277 North onto Exit 1E/S College Street. Drive .4 miles, and the convention center will be on the right.
  • From I-77 South/I-85 South and North/US Highway 74 East (Independence Boulevard), exit off I-277 South onto Exit 1E/Brooklyn Village Avenue. Turn left onto Brooklyn Village Avenue. At the third light, take a right onto College Street. The convention center will be on the right.

What are the qualifications to attend HPX?

HPX requires proof that your business or employer is a current and legitimate automotive aftermarket business. You must supply documentation as proof that you are currently employed by or own the company you register under, such as:

  • Current and valid business license
  • Current and valid tax registration certificate or business registration
  • Recent paycheck stubs (from an automated payroll system, handwritten company checks are not acceptable)
  • Business cards are not accepted as proof of employment

All registrations will be considered “pended” until reviewed and approved.

If you do not meet the above listed qualifications, enthusiasts are able to purchase the “Thursday only” or weekend badge.

Can my child attend HPX?

Yes. Children under the age of 18 must be accompanied and supervised by an adult at all times adult at all times (during show hours). Registration of children is complimentary and must be done onsite and a waiver must be signed. All children except infants in backpacks or slings must be registered and display a badge to be admitted to the show floor. Strollers for children are permitted on the show floor during published show hours. Attendees assume all risks associated with the use of strollers on the show floor, including but not limited to personal injury or property damage. NOTE: No one under the age of 18 is allowed on the show floor during move-in and move-out.

What does right-to-work mean?

North Carolina is a “right-to-work” state. Exhibitor personnel may set up their own exhibits if so desired; however, labor is available to assist in the installation and dismantle of exhibit booths. Exhibit labor, freight and rigging labor, electricians and plumbers can be arranged at established rates, using the order forms in the Exhibitor Service Kit.
